Minahito
minah****@users*****
2006年 7月 20日 (木) 17:18:39 JST
Index: xoops2jp/html/kernel/module.php diff -u xoops2jp/html/kernel/module.php:1.2.8.12 xoops2jp/html/kernel/module.php:1.2.8.13 --- xoops2jp/html/kernel/module.php:1.2.8.12 Sun Jul 16 15:41:33 2006 +++ xoops2jp/html/kernel/module.php Thu Jul 20 17:18:39 2006 @@ -1,5 +1,5 @@ <?php -// $Id: module.php,v 1.2.8.12 2006/07/16 06:41:33 minahito Exp $ +// $Id: module.php,v 1.2.8.13 2006/07/20 08:18:39 minahito Exp $ // ------------------------------------------------------------------------ // // XOOPS - PHP Content Management System // // Copyright (c) 2000 XOOPS.org // @@ -197,11 +197,9 @@ return; } - if (file_exists(XOOPS_ROOT_PATH.'/modules/'.$dirname.'/language/'.$xoopsConfig['language'].'/modinfo.php')) { - include_once XOOPS_ROOT_PATH.'/modules/'.$dirname.'/language/'.$xoopsConfig['language'].'/modinfo.php'; - } elseif (file_exists(XOOPS_ROOT_PATH.'/modules/'.$dirname.'/language/english/modinfo.php')) { - include_once XOOPS_ROOT_PATH.'/modules/'.$dirname.'/language/english/modinfo.php'; - } + $root =& XCube_Root::getSingleton(); + $root->mLanguageManager->loadModinfoMessageCatalog($dirname); + if (file_exists(XOOPS_ROOT_PATH.'/modules/'.$dirname.'/xoops_version.php')) { include XOOPS_ROOT_PATH.'/modules/'.$dirname.'/xoops_version.php'; } else {